2. Key Differences Analysis

Xiaomi Redmi Note 10 Advantages:

  • Lighter Weight: The Redmi Note 10 is significantly lighter (23g less), making it more comfortable for extended periods of use.
  • Slightly Wider Aperture (Main Camera): f/1.79 aperture may perform slightly better in very low light, though sensor differences likely negate this.
  • Slightly Larger Selfie Sensor: The selfie camera sensor on the Note 10 is slightly larger, which might result in better low light selfies, though its not as great as the Note 12 Pro 4G's higher resolution.

Xiaomi Redmi Note 12 Pro 4G Advantages:

  • Newer Model: The Note 12 Pro 4G is a more recent model, likely providing longer software support and more up-to-date features.
  • Superior Performance: The Snapdragon 732G and Adreno 618 offer significantly better performance, resulting in faster app loading, smoother multitasking, and better gaming.
  • Higher Refresh Rate Display: The 120Hz refresh rate display offers much smoother scrolling and animations, especially noticeable in gaming and social media browsing.
  • Faster Charging: 67W fast charging is significantly faster than 33W charging, meaning less time waiting for the battery to charge.
  • Higher Resolution Main Camera: The 108MP camera captures more detailed photos, especially in good light.
  • More Storage Options: The availability of 256GB internal storage provides ample space for media.
  • Newer Bluetooth version: Offers improved efficiency and stability when connecting to devices.
  • Better Screen Protection: Gorilla Glass 5 is more resistant to scratches and impacts compared to Gorilla Glass 3.
  • Additional Camera Features: Offers more features such as continuous autofocus, continuous shooting, panorama, and RAW capture for more flexibility.
  • Larger Display: Offers slightly larger viewing area.
  • More RAM options: Available in 8GB configurations for better multitasking.

Significant Trade-offs:

  • Weight: The Note 12 Pro 4G is heavier, which could be a disadvantage for some users.
  • Size: The Note 12 Pro 4G is slightly larger, making it slightly less pocketable and less comfortable for single-handed use than the Note 10.

My Choice

If I had to choose, I would pick the Xiaomi Redmi Note 12 Pro 4G. The performance boost from the Snapdragon 732G and 120Hz display are significant advantages for a more modern experience. The faster charging is also a really useful practical feature for everyday use. While the Note 10 has its strengths, the Note 12 Pro 4G is a better all-around package and provides better performance that will last longer into the future. Additionally, the significantly better main camera and more storage are great benefits. The additional weight and slight increase in size is a worthy trade-off for the better overall experience.
